Paul Gavarni, Les rats couchés, nous sommes venus... (The rats asleep, we have arrived.), plate XI from the series Le Carnaval à Paris, January 6, 1842, published in Le Charivari, lithograph on newsprint, Gift of Dr. Karl Paley Cohen and Mrs. Marthe-Hermance Cohen, public domain, ST906(93)
